Can I meet with an Arlington Medicare agent in person?
Yes. We meet by appointment — our office is nearby in Vienna, just across the county line, or we can come to you. Plenty of Arlington clients prefer to handle everything by phone, and we're happy to do that too.
Will my Arlington-area doctors and hospitals be covered?
On a Medicare Advantage plan it depends on that plan's network, so we verify your specific doctors and hospitals — including Virginia Hospital Center (VHC Health) — are in network before you enroll. If you choose a Medicare Supplement (Medigap) plan instead, you can see any doctor or hospital that accepts Medicare, with no network to worry about.
Do you charge Arlington residents for help?
No, our help is completely free. The insurance carriers pay us when we place a policy, and by law your premium is exactly the same whether you use an agent or enroll on your own.
When can I enroll or change plans?
During your Initial Enrollment Period around your 65th birthday, during the Annual Enrollment Period (Oct 15 – Dec 7), or during a Special Enrollment Period triggered by a qualifying event — such as moving to or within Arlington.
